Re: K3 - Good deal on eHam??

Rick Robinson
This from Eham:"W6ZR" K3/Omni VII ads: scams/impersonat

The text of today's two W6ZR ads are copied from earlier ads on other sites
(Google some ad phrases to see them - an OMNI VII ad by W4CAK in 4/2011,
and a K3 ad by W0IQ in 12/2012). I've contacted the real W6ZR (an honest
ham) by phone and he confirmed these are scams, and not posted by him. -
W9XC

K3/0 DC power

Milt -- N5IA
All,

I was looking at the pictorial diagram of the connections for the K3/0 to a
RemoteRig control unit in the K3/0 on line Owner's manual.

In the pictorial diagram on page Ten I note there is no DC power IN
connector on the K3/0; only a DC out connector a la K3.

And nowhere in the set up instructions do I see anything mentioning how to
power the unit.

Can someone illuminate this ol' boy's mind with information how they are
powering the K3/0?

Thanks in advance.

de Milt, N5IA

Re: K3/0 DC power

Don Wilhelm-4
Milt,

The K3/0 power input is the normal K3 12v power output jack.
Because this is an RCA jack, you might want to consider making an
adapter cable that has a different jack (APP or other jack).
If you leave the RCA plug connected to the K3/0 at all times, there is
no problem, but I do not like the prospect of having an RCA plug on my
workbench with its exposed +12V pin.

As I said, if that plug is always inserted into the K2/0, everything is
safe, but if you are in the habit of disconnecting the power plug to the
K3/0, make an adapter and leave the adapter connected to the K3/0 - all
that is my personal safety consideration.  Several QRP kits also use an
RCA plug for 12v power input, so the K3/0 implementation is not that
unusual.  Leave the RCA plug connected and disconnect the power supply
end for safety.
.
73,
Don W3FPR
